새로운 NoSQL 프로젝트를 추진하는 관계형 데이터베이스의 한계

마운틴뷰, 캘리포니아 - 2012년 2월 8일 - Couchbase, Inc.에서 NoSQL 시장 점유율 1위 기업인 오라클은 오늘 12월에 실시한 업계 설문조사 결과를 발표하며 2012년 NoSQL 도입이 증가하고 있음을 보여주었습니다. 설문조사에 따르면, 1,300여 명의 응답자 중 대다수가 내년에 NoSQL 프로젝트에 투자할 계획이며, 이 기술이 회사의 일상 업무에 더욱 중요해지거나 핵심이 되고 있다고 답했습니다. 또한 응답자들은 관계형 기술과 관련된 유연성 부족/경직된 스키마가 NoSQL 도입의 주요 동인이라고 답했습니다. NoSQL 데이터베이스는 스키마가 없으며 사용자가 비즈니스의 변화하는 요구 사항을 지원하기 위해 애플리케이션을 쉽게 변경할 수 있습니다.

"이번 설문조사 결과를 보면 NoSQL이 실험 단계를 넘어섰다는 것이 분명해 보입니다."라고 Couchbase의 CEO인 밥 위더홀드는 말합니다. "2012년은 모든 규모의 기업이 애플리케이션의 데이터 관리 요구 사항을 충족하기 위해 NoSQL 데이터베이스 기술에 투자하고 이를 보다 심층적으로 활용하는 획기적인 해가 될 것으로 예상합니다."라고 말합니다.

NoSQL 2012 설문조사 주요 내용

Couchbase NoSQL 설문조사의 주요 데이터 포인트는 다음과 같습니다:

  • 1,300명이 넘는 응답자 중 거의 절반이 올해 상반기에 NoSQL 프로젝트에 자금을 지원한 적이 있다고 답했습니다. 250명 이상의 개발자를 보유한 기업의 경우, 2012년 한 해 동안 70%에 가까운 기업이 NoSQL 프로젝트에 자금을 지원할 계획이라고 답했습니다.
  • 49%는 경직된 스키마를 관계형 데이터베이스 기술에서 NoSQL로 마이그레이션한 주요 원인으로 꼽았습니다. 확장성 부족과 높은 지연 시간/낮은 성능도 NoSQL로 마이그레이션하는 이유 중 높은 순위를 차지했습니다(자세한 내용은 아래 차트 참조).
  • 전체적으로 40%가 일상 업무에 매우 중요하거나 매우 중요하다고 답했으며, 37%는 점점 더 중요해지고 있다고 답했습니다.

     

카우치베이스의 설문조사에서 응답자들은 현재 사용 사례를 확인했으며, 그 결과 NoSQL 기술의 애플리케이션 및 업계 채택이 다양화되고 있음을 알 수 있었습니다. 그 예는 다음과 같습니다:

  • 광고 타겟팅을 위한 사용자 실시간 추적 및 세분화
  • 재해 복구
  • 재고 추적
  • 제조 자동화
  • 보험 언더라이팅
  • 멀티 콜센터 운영(프로덕션 데이터 복제 포함)
  • 트위터 스트림 분석

추가 댓글

응답자들에게 "2012년에 NoSQL 기술이 가져올 가장 큰 기대/희망은 무엇입니까?"라는 질문을 던졌습니다. (주제별로 그룹화된) 전체 응답은 다음과 같습니다:

  • 스키마
    • "변화하는 비즈니스 요구 사항에 적응하기 어려운 유연하지 못한 스키마 문제에서 벗어날 수 있습니다."
    • "기존의 경직된 데이터스토어를 폐기하고 보다 효율적이고 유연한 스토리지로 교체"
    • "값비싼 스키마 변경으로부터 우리를 보호하세요. 수평적 확장 간소화"
  • RDBMS 교체/기본 데이터베이스 되기
    • 일상 업무의 필수적인 부분이 되어 최소 30%의 트랜잭션 부하를 처리합니다."
    • "Microsoft SQL Server를 최대한 많이 교체"
    • "2012년에 드디어 MySQL 사용을 중단할 수 있기를 바랍니다."
    • "오라클에서 벗어나라고요? 성능 향상?"
  • 확장성/성능
    • "여러 상품 서버에 걸쳐 수십억 개의 문서를 샤딩할 수 있습니다."
    • "확장보다는 축소를 해야 합니다. MySQL 복제의 한계에 부딪히기 시작했고, 전송하는 데이터의 종류를 처리하지 못하고 있습니다."
    • "비용 절감, 지연 시간 단축"
    • "더 높은 성능, 서버를 최대한 활용"
  • 앱 개발의 속도와 민첩성
    • "새로운 애플리케이션의 개발 민첩성"
    • "더 빠른 개발과 데이터베이스 경합 감소"
    • "SQL 패치 스크립트 및 마이그레이션을 관리할 필요 없이 새로운 기능을 더 빠르게 배포할 수 있도록 도와주세요."

추가 리소스

카우치베이스 소개

카우치베이스는 데이터가 기업의 핵심이라고 믿습니다. 개발자와 아키텍트가 가장 미션 크리티컬한 애플리케이션을 구축, 배포, 실행할 수 있도록 지원합니다. Couchbase는 데이터센터와 모든 클라우드에서 실행되는 유연하고 확장 가능한 고성능의 최신 데이터베이스를 제공합니다. 세계 최대 규모의 많은 기업들이 비즈니스에 필수적인 핵심 애플리케이션을 구동하기 위해 Couchbase를 사용하고 있습니다. 자세한 내용은 다음을 참조하세요. www.couchbase.com.

미디어 연락처

제임스 김

couchbasePR@couchbase.com
카우치베이스 커뮤니케이션

구축 시작

개발자 포털에서 NoSQL을 살펴보고, 리소스를 찾아보고, 튜토리얼을 시작하세요.

카펠라 무료 체험

클릭 몇 번으로 Couchbase를 직접 체험해 보세요. Capella DBaaS는 가장 쉽고 빠르게 시작할 수 있는 방법입니다.

다운로드 콜아웃

복잡성과 비용을 줄이면서 강력한 앱을 구축하세요.